Yes, MacOS includes Preview, a built-in application that allows basic PDF editing and annotation. For more advanced features, consider additional software compatible with your MacOS version.
Yes, Preview lets you view, annotate, and perform basic edits on PDFs. For complex modifications, exploring external PDF editing applications might be beneficial.
